#364527 Color Information
#364527 RGB value is (54, 69, 39). The hex color red value is 54, green is 69, and blue is 39. Its HSL format shows a hue of 90°, saturation of 28 percent, and lightness of21 percent. The CMYK process values are 22 percent, 0 percent, 43 percent, 73percent.

Analogous
Colors adjacent on the color wheel (30° apart)
Complementary
Colors opposite on the color wheel (180° apart)
Split Complementary
Three colors using one base hue and the two hues beside its opposite
Triadic
Three colors evenly spaced (120° apart)
Tetradic
Four colors forming a rectangle on the wheel
Square
Four colors evenly spaced (90° apart)
Double Split
Four colors formed from two base hues and the colors next to their opposites
Monochromatic
Variations of a single hue
